Growth Drivers:

  • Surging Demand from Key Industries:
    • Aerospace & Defense: The global aerospace & defense industry is driven by increasing defense spending and the development of next-generation aircraft. Prepregs are crucial materials in this sector due to their superior strength-to-weight ratio and fatigue resistance, leading to lighter, more fuel-efficient aircraft.
    • Automotive: Growing urbanization and rising disposable incomes are fueling the global automotive industry. Prepregs offer significant weight reduction in vehicles, leading to improved fuel efficiency and reduced emissions, making them ideal for electric and hybrid vehicles.
    • Wind Energy: The global wind energy market is driven by the growing demand for renewable energy sources. Prepregs are vital in the manufacturing of wind turbine blades due to their superior strength, stiffness, and weather resistance.
    • Electronics: The booming electronics industry is another key driver of prepreg demand. Prepregs are used in various electronic components due to their excellent electrical insulation properties and high thermal conductivity.

Emerging Trends:

  • Increased Adoption of Thermoplastic Prepregs: Thermoplastic prepregs offer advantages like faster processing times and recyclability, leading to their growing popularity in various sectors.
  • Focus on Sustainable Prepreg Solutions: The development of eco-friendly prepregs using bio-based resins and recycled materials is gaining traction.
  • Integration of Artificial Intelligence (AI) and Machine Learning (ML): AI and ML are being employed to optimize prepreg manufacturing processes and predict material performance, leading to improved efficiency and reliability.
  • Customization and On-demand Production: The increasing demand for customized prepreg solutions is driving the development of on-demand manufacturing technologies.

Market Challenges:

  • High Cost: Despite technological advancements, the high cost of prepregs compared to traditional materials remains a barrier to their wider adoption.
  • Limited Availability of Skilled Workforce: The specialized skills required for prepreg manufacturing limit the growth of the market, particularly in developing regions.
  • Stringent Regulations: Stringent regulations related to the handling and disposal of hazardous materials can pose challenges for prepreg manufacturers.
